In 2015, the Japanese Supreme Court upheld the constitutionality of the regulation, noting that girls could use their maiden names informally, and stating that it was for the legislature to resolve on whether or not to pass new legislation on separate spousal names. By 1898, cruelty was added to the grounds for a lady to divorce; the regulation also allowed divorce via mutual settlement of the husband and spouse. However, children have been assumed to stay with the male head of the family. In contemporary Japan, youngsters usually tend to stay with single moms than single fathers; in 2013, 7.4% of children were living in single-mother households; only one.3% live with their fathers. Finally, Japan is a rustic during which labor unions are weak, and often concentrate on collaborating with companies and preserving the great jobs that do exist, rather than preventing on behalf of all workers, based on Konno. “Unions listed right here are for the companies—they’re not efficient,” he mentioned. Of course, Japan is not unique in having employees who say they really feel abused and overworked by their employers. Nor is it the only country that has seen a rise in temporary staff in today’s economic system. But a few issues differentiate Japan from the United States and other developed economies. The first is that regular employment is still deeply valued in Japanese tradition, so much so that people who can’t discover common employment, regardless of their skills, are sometimes criticized in a way that individuals in different international locations may not be. “There’s a bent, when somebody does not have a job, to blame them,” Nishida, the professor, stated.

At POSSE, I met a younger man named Jou Matsubara, who graduated from Rikkyo Daigaku, a prestigious non-public college in Japan. Matsubara, who comes from a working-class household, thought he’d achieved the Japanese dream when he graduated from faculty and received a job at Daiwa House Group, a Japanese house builder. I additionally visited the workplace of POSSE, a group fashioned by college graduates who wanted to create a labor union for younger people. Haruki Konno, the group’s president, advised me that a few of the younger men in irregular jobs turn into what are called “net-cafe refugees”—people who reside in the tiny cubicles obtainable for hire overnight at Japanese internet cafes. (Shiho Fukada, a photographer, has documented the lives of those “refugees.”) Others with irregular jobs live with their mother and father or go on welfare. While extra girls have certainly joined the workforce, many stay in part-time or non-career observe roles, which won’t permit them to access the top jobs. In the non-public sector, the number of feminine managers rose to 7.8% in 2019, but that’s nonetheless nowhere close to the 30% target, which the federal government has quietly pushed again to 2030. And in politics, ladies make up just 9.9% of lawmakers in parliament’s more highly effective lower house – rating Japan 166th out of 193 countries. This encouragement has led to a norm by which husbands work very long hours, whereas home tasks and childrearing still fall primarily on wives.

Japan is ranked a lowly a hundred and twentieth out of the 156 nations on the World Economic Forum’s Global Gender Gap Index for 2020, highlighting the stark gap between the genders when it comes to political empowerment and financial opportunity. For many years, Japan has been enhancing the generosity of applications aimed at enhancing women’s standing in the labor market, and extra just lately Japan’s management has argued that the most important path to economic development is to maximise visit women’s function within the economic system. During that time they have seen a major enchancment in women’s labor drive participation that’s not easily explained by demographic developments. This helps underline the sizable potential financial impacts of creating the labor market work higher for women. Japan managed to increase the labor force participation of groups that were badly lagging and introduced them up to the typical participation price of women.

Moreover, the labor pressure participation fee in 2016 for Japanese ladies 15 and older (50.4 percent) is decrease than that of the United States (56.eight %, excluding 15-yearolds), largely as a end result of the fact that the Japanese inhabitants is considerably older. Of course, it could be that work other than full-time and common employment is a better fit for the circumstances and preferences of some working women. The prepared availability of options like part-time work and paid parental go away appear tofacilitatelabor force participationin many instances by making it simpler for women to steadiness employment with non-work obligations. The challenge for coverage makers is to design these insurance policies in such a way that they assist women’s labor drive participation and not utilizing a diminution in the quality of women’s labor market outcomes, like earnings and illustration in enterprise management. Labor force participation can respond to deliberate coverage choices along with demographic and financial trends.
